JV Baseball Defeats Frankfort

The Western Boone junior varsity baseball team completed a conference sweep of Frankfort with a 16-6 victory over the Hot Dogs in five innings Thursday night. Liam Whiteley led the Stars at the plate, going a perfect 3-for-3 with two doubles and a single. He also drew one walk on the night. He doubled in both the first and third innings and added an RBI single during Western Boone’s big third inning. The Stars got on the board early after a passed ball brought home the game’s first run in the opening inning. Western Boone broke the game open in the third, scoring eight runs on six hits. Whiteley started the rally with an RBI single, while Drew Potts worked a bases-loaded walk to bring in another run. Caleb Keyes added a two-run single, and the Stars also scored on a steal of home. Braedyn Mathews was hit by a pitch with the bases loaded to force in a run, Jackson Bloss delivered an RBI single, and Whiteley capped the inning with an RBI double. The Stars finished things off with a six-run fifth inning. Sam Rausch and Luke Shirley each drove in a run with singles, Keyes added another RBI hit, and Landon Smith brought home a run on a SAC groundout. Bloss ended the game in walk-off fashion with a two-run single to right field. Whiteley earned the win on the mound, allowing six runs — only three earned — on four hits over five innings. He struck out seven and walked three while throwing just 84 pitches. Western Boone totaled 11 hits in the win. Whiteley and Bloss each collected three hits, while Keyes finished 2-for-3 with a team-high three RBIs. Rausch added two hits, and Potts showed patience at the plate with three walks as the Stars drew nine free passes overall. Masyn Hoskins and Destin Caraballo each contributed on defense, allowing the Stars to stay on track. The Stars were also aggressive on the bases, swiping seven steals. Rausch and Shirley each stole multiple bases, while Keyes, Potts, and Whiteley added one apiece. The JV Stars look to finish their season off strong on Monday as they host the Mounties of Southmont for their last game of the season.
